复制
收藏
提问
简洁
<uni-data-select v-model="form.phase" :clear="false" placeholder="请选择单三相22" :localdata="XWLXlist">设置默认选中单相
2个月前
全网
文档
学术
百科
知识库
回答简洁模式
深入研究一些
uni-data-select 设置默认选中项
- 定义数据模型:首先需要在组件的
data
函数中定义一个变量,用于存储选中的数据。16 - 绑定 v-model:使用
v-model
绑定该变量到<uni-data-select>
组件上。17 - 配置 localdata:通过
:localdata
属性传递一个数组,数组中包含对象,每个对象至少包含text
和value
两个属性。47 - 设置默认值:在
localdata
数组中的对象设置一个默认的value
,然后在v-model
绑定的变量中设置相同的值作为默认选中项。10
示例代码
<template>
<uni-data-select v-model="form.phase" :clear="false" placeholder="请选择单三相22" :localdata="XWLXlist"></uni-data-select>
</template>
<script>
import { ref } from 'vue';
export default {
setup() {
const form = ref({
phase: 1 // 假设默认选中项的值为 1
});
const XWLXlist = ref([
{ value: 0, text: "单相" },
{ value: 1, text: "三相" }
]);
return {
form,
XWLXlist
};
}
}
</script>
在上述代码中,form.phase
被设置为默认选中项的值,XWLXlist
包含了选项列表,其中 value
为选项的值,text
为显示的文本。通过这种方式,可以设置 <uni-data-select>
组件的默认选中项。7
你觉得结果怎么样?